Which of the following desalination plants will always require a sterilizer when providing water to a potable water system?

AI Explanation
The correct answer is D) Reverse osmosis type unit. Reverse osmosis (RO) desalination plants require a sterilizer when providing water to a potable water system because the RO process alone does not effectively remove all microorganisms from the water. RO membranes have pore sizes that can allow some bacteria and viruses to pass through, so a disinfection step is necessary to ensure the water is safe for human consumption. The other desalination methods (titanium plate, multi-stage flash, and submerged tube) typically have more effective mechanisms for removing microorganisms, so a sterilizer may not be required in those cases.
